Abstract: The invention relates to a nozzle for projecting powdered solid products intended for coating objects, of the kind comprising a device for shaping the incident mixture consisting of said powdered solid and its conveyor gas, into an outlet jet of substantially flat form, said nozzle essentially comprising a plurality of separate pipes passing at least partly through the nozzle in the direction of emission of the jet, and intended to be completely traversed by a specific portion of said jet, each of said separate pipes being provided with a suction device for said incident mixture, said suction devices being of the Venturi type, each comprising at least one conduit for injecting a flow of auxiliary gas into said pipes. Especially advantageous applications of the invention are found in the field of electrostatic powdercoating apparatus.

Abstract: An electrostatic powder coating system in which one or more powder base layers and a powder top coating layer are sequentially deposited without any form of intermediate heating being applied to the articles being coated, with a final common application of heat to the multi-coated article, uses devices which prevent the covering layer deposited from being contaminated by impurities. The articles are conveyed by an overhead system between cabins incorporating a powder extraction system to prevent the base layer, e.g. black or blue, for enamelling, from contaminating the top layer which is e.g. white.

Abstract: After the workpieces have been conveyed through >=1 cabin and sprayed with the enamel powder, they are transferred to a baking plant, whereas the carriers pass through a cleaning cabin. The carriers or balancers are suspended from the conveyor by hooks so they are free to vibrate. In the cleaning cabin, a pneumatic sensor detects the presence of the carrier and feeds a signal to a pneumatic logic circuit so air is fed to a pneumatic cylinder driving a hammer fitted on its rear end with a counterweight. The hammer applies several blows to each carrier so the grains of powder fall off leaving a clean carrier. Simple and efficient removal of powder from the carriers, is achieved.

Abstract: Appts. for enamelling objects by electrostatically applying a powder, consists of (a) a device for supplying the correct amt. of powder and which is equipped with pneumatic ejectors, (b) pipes for transporting the powder and (c) >=1 electrostatic projectors. All of these being especially constructed for handling enamel powders. Enamels are applied to kitchen utensils and to casings of electrical domestic appliances. Compared with electrostatically applying a slip, the use of powders is more economic since any powder which has not adhered to the prod. can be recycled.

Abstract: An electrostatic spray ahead for enamel powder had a body (1) with a conductive ring (2) at the rear with a sleeve (3) extending from it with a deflector (4) at the front, and side discharge holes (10). Powder is discharged through them onto the interior of the body, assisted by air blown through channels (8) outside the sleeve. The powder is charged by needle pointed ele ctrodes (5) connected to the conductive ring, housed inside holes through the body so that they are protected from abrasion by the powder. Parts such as the body (1), the sleeve (3) and the deflector are made of ceramic to resist abrasion by the powder.

Abstract: A powder feed device for supplying a powder dispensing apparatus such as a powder spray gun of an electrostatic powder deposition system. Entrained powder is extracted from a fluidization tank and transported through a half-inch diameter tube or hose to the dispensing apparatus. To prevent clumps of powder and/or powder adhering to the walls of the tube or hose while permitting reduced air flow speed of about 2 to 3 m/s an electric field is provided in the tube or hose and applied by an outer conductor extending around the tube or hose and an inner wire conductor inside the tube or hose extending in the direction of the flow of entrained powder, which conductors are connected across an AC voltage source. The electric field may operate constantly or intermittently.

Abstract: Process for coating objects by electrostatic spraying with enamel powder, the novelty being that, in spraying a cloud of any desired type of electrostatic powder coating, means are employed so the average specific resistance (ASR) of the cloud matches the requirements for good spraying. The means pref. provide an ASR high enough to ensure good electrostatic adhesion, but low enough to avoid counter-emission; and the coating thickness is pref. controlled by adjusting the ASR. The pref. means are (a) heating the fluidising air for the powder feed funnel(s) and possibly the carrier air; (b) mixing fresh powder with recycled powder, esp. using 30-50% fresh powder in the mixt. The powder coating obtd. have good adhesion, without crater formation.
